Are there exemptions for classic cars from the ULEZ in London?

What exemptions are available to enthusiasts using 25+-year-old cars as daily drivers as ULEZ expands in London and with other cities contemplating introducing similar restrictions? Would an engine upgrade giving Euro 5 compliance on emissions work?

Asked on 18 January 2019 by Gerald

Answered by Keith Moody
At present, proposed exemptions fall in line with the MoT and free road tax cut-off date of 40 years or more. Any car with a pre-Euro 4 powertrain (approximately 2003 for petrol cars and 2008 for diesel) will be faced with the ULEZ charge. There are currently no plans to change this. The charge is based on the vehicle's specific launch data, so an engine change will sadly make no difference.
